Definition

Ecological surveys are systematic assessments aimed at collecting data about the structure, composition, and functioning of ecosystems. These surveys are crucial for understanding biodiversity and ecological dynamics, helping to inform the design, implementation, and management of marine protected areas. Through these surveys, researchers can identify species distributions, assess habitat conditions, and monitor changes over time, which are vital for effective conservation strategies.

5 Must Know Facts For Your Next Test

  1. Ecological surveys can be conducted using various methods, including visual surveys, sampling techniques, and remote sensing technologies.
  2. These surveys help establish baseline data that is essential for evaluating the effectiveness of marine protected areas over time.
  3. Ecological surveys can highlight areas of high biodiversity or unique ecosystems that may require special management attention within protected areas.
  4. The results from ecological surveys can inform policymakers about the potential impacts of human activities on marine ecosystems and guide conservation efforts.
  5. Data collected from these surveys can also be used to engage local communities in conservation efforts by demonstrating the ecological value of their resources.

Review Questions

  • How do ecological surveys contribute to the understanding and management of marine protected areas?
    • Ecological surveys provide critical data on species diversity, habitat health, and ecosystem dynamics, which are essential for effective management of marine protected areas. By identifying key species and habitats, these surveys help determine where protection efforts should be focused. They also establish baseline conditions that allow for monitoring changes over time, ensuring that management strategies can adapt to evolving ecological scenarios.
  • Discuss the importance of baseline data obtained from ecological surveys in the evaluation of marine protected area effectiveness.
    • Baseline data from ecological surveys serve as a reference point against which future changes in biodiversity and habitat conditions can be measured. This information is crucial for evaluating the success of management practices within marine protected areas. By comparing current data with baseline conditions, researchers can assess whether conservation efforts are achieving desired outcomes or if adjustments are needed to enhance protection measures.
  • Evaluate the role of community engagement in the implementation of ecological surveys within marine protected areas and its effects on conservation efforts.
    • Community engagement is vital for the success of ecological surveys as it fosters local stewardship and enhances conservation outcomes. When communities are involved in data collection and analysis, they develop a deeper understanding of their marine environments, which can lead to more effective conservation actions. Furthermore, engaged communities are more likely to support regulations and initiatives aimed at protecting marine resources, ultimately contributing to healthier ecosystems and improved management of marine protected areas.
